Friday 25th - Sunday 27th November 2011 Stratford Weekend Conference.
Venue: Legacy Falcon Hotel, Chapel Street, Stratford-upon-Avon, CV37 6HA.
Assorted lectures at a leisurely pace, from Friday evening to Sunday lunchtime.
CABK dinner on Saturday.

Main speakers

Dr Karin Alton, Bee Research at LASI (Sussex University)
Micheal Mac Giolla Coda, Conservation & Improvement of the Dark Irish Bee
Stuart Masson, An update on the ALARM Project
Will Messenger, The Beekeeping Experts (to 1939)
Prof David Wallis, Food-sharing Behaviour & Social Cohesion in Ants

Something new!

We will also have four PhD students presenting their work and we hope also to have a poster session of their work.

•  Edward Haynes, York University EFB epidemiology
•  Riccardo Kather, Sheffield University The honey bee and the Varroa mite: a tale of friends and foes and haunted hives
•  Katherine Roberts, Leeds University Molecular studies on Nosema
•  Catherine Thompson, Leeds University Exploring England and Wales' unmanaged honey bee population and the remaining Apis mellifera mellifera population
